Job Title – Team Leader (contact centre) Location – Glasgow city centre Hours of work – 40 hours, including evenings & Saturdays. ACES is a pioneering independent provider of NHS ophthalmic care in the community and patient care is at the heart of everything we do. We have been providing NHS eye care since 2005 and will be expanding in 2024 and beyond. We provide a range of services including cataract surgery, YAG laser treatment, glaucoma treatment, oculoplastics and general ophthalmology. Due to an increase in demand for the service we offer, we have an exciting opportunity for an experienced Contact Centre Team Leader to join us. Reporting directly to our Waiting List Administration Manager, the Team Leader will be responsible for: Boosting call handler performance by effective management and coaching. Training new & existing agents to provide the perfect patient experience. Ensuring all KPIs and SLAs are achieved. Monitoring call answering to ensure calls are taken in a timely manner. Providing accurate information about our services. Establishing and maintaining excellent patient relationships. Liaising with professional and clinical staff within the service to discuss queries and action as required. Undertaking other duties as necessary to support the smooth running of the service. To be successful in this role you must have: Ability to multi-task and work to deadlines. Flexibility in approach to working hours and shifts. Minimum of 1-2 years team leading experience in a contact centre. Excellent computing and administration skills. Excellent communication skills. What’s in it for you? A competitive salary. State of the art, modern working environment. 29 days’ annual leave per year. Pension scheme. Free Laser Eye Surgery and Intraocular Lens Surgery. Free eye tests. Discounted prescription eyewear and sunglasses. Generous Optical Express friends and family discount scheme. Ongoing training and development opportunities. Please apply now by uploading your CV.
